Join FMA Chief Executive Samantha Barrass as she shares an overview of the Financial Conduct Report (FCR) and what it means for the year ahead.The Financial Conduct Report sets out the FMA’s regulatory priorities for the next 12 months, highlighting the key risks and opportunities we see across financial markets and how we plan to respond. It also reflects on the progress made over the past year to support better outcomes for consumers, investors and businesses. In this episode, Sam discusses why the FCR is an important tool for industry, providing greater transparency on our expectations and helping firms understand where we are focusing our supervision and engagement. She also outlines what boards, executives and leaders should be considering, and how organisations can use the insights from the report to strengthen their approach to conduct and deliver better outcomes for their customers.Watch now for a clear overview of the FMA’s priorities and how industry can engage with us over the coming year.
